FInally got my stripped lower tonight
I have been gone for a week at a trade show and waiting for my stripped lower , Of course it came while I was gone but I picked it up tonight and got her all put together in about 45 minutes, Took my time and did everything right , Ran about 8 rounds of electrical tape around the receiver to keep from scratching it up when putting in the bolt catch roll pin . Turned out perfect , I was a little disappointed in the trigger on this one its not quite as smooth as my other AR but its not terrible either , Im sure it will get better after putting some rds down range . I can honestly say its a little intimidating when you dump all that stuff out with all those springs , detents, levers ,etc but its really pretty simple once you get going on it . The key is taking your time and being careful driving pins in and having fun getting to know all the internals and how they work .
